520    Parenting children with ADHD, whether diagnosed or 
       undiagnosed, can be challenging and complex. But just as a
       child who struggles with reading can learn to decode words,
       children with ADHD can learn patience, communication, and 
       solution-seeking skills to become more confident, 
       independent, and capable. This book, rich with optimism, 
       tips, tools, and action plans, offers science-based 
       insights and systems for parents to help cultivate these 
       skills. Combining expert information with practical, 
       sensitive advice, the eight "key" concepts here will help 
       parents reduce chaos, improve cooperation, and nurture the
       advantageslike creativity and drivethat often accompany 
       all of that energy.|cprovided by the publisher.
